Even if the company has been the operating company for two dry wells, they are prepared to spend D.kr. 300 million on seismic [...] so if we are to continue to work in the Faroes, it will be necessary to resolve the “basalt problem”. The great challenge with basalt can be divided into two separate parts. The first is to “see” properly [...] data and the second is to drill through the basalt.
